PRAKTIK KEPEMIMPINAN KEPALA MADRASAH DALAM MENGELOLA PROGRAM PENINGKATAN KOMPETENSI GURU NON-LINEAR DI ERA KURIKULUM MERDEKA DI SMK HAMPAR BAIDURI KALIANDA TAHUN AJARAN 2025/2026

school leadership, non-linear teachers, Merdeka Curriculum.Abstract
This study aims to describe the leadership practices of the school principal in managing competency development programs for non-linear teachers during the implementation of the Merdeka Curriculum at SMK Hampar Baiduri Kalianda in the 2025/2026 academic year. This research employed a qualitative case study approach. Data were collected through in-depth interviews, observations of training and supervision sessions, and documentation analysis, including lesson plans, training reports, and supervision records. The data were analyzed using Miles and Huberman’s interactive model, consisting of data reduction, data display, and conclusion drawing. The findings indicate that the principal implemented several leadership strategies, including mapping teacher needs, designing internal training based on vocational competencies, facilitating professional learning communities, and establishing partnerships with industries to strengthen teachers’ technical knowledge. The principal also applied academic supervision based on coaching and reflective dialogue to enhance the pedagogical skills of non-linear teachers. In addition to technical support, the principal provided emotional support, motivation, and appreciation to increase teacher confidence. Challenges identified in the implementation include limited practice facilities, varying baseline competencies among teachers, and the complexity of the Merdeka Curriculum. However, these challenges were addressed through adaptive leadership strategies and flexible policy adjustments. Overall, the study concludes that the principal’s leadership practices play a crucial role in improving the competence of non-linear teachers and supporting the successful implementation of the Merdeka Curriculum at the school.
